stands a chance to be the cam if its a knocking noise or it might just be the alternator...the bearings go dry & need changing!! but its hard to get to!! could be cambelt tensioner and rollers water pump or lack of oil first two could cause catastrophic engine loss if left Could also be a blowing Exhaust manifold gasket, or cracked exhaust manifold.
